The news of the death of a young man leads two young men to attack each other

A message via WhatsApp about the death of a young man caused a dispute between a group of friends in the "group", which reached the point of beating one of them for not believing the news of the death of their friend, accusing him of mocking him after his death, and as a result the Public Prosecution in Ras Al Khaimah accused Two Gulf youths assaulting each other's body, beating each other, and inflicting varying injuries on each other.

The Juvenile Misdemeanor Court in the Ras Al Khaimah Courts Department began the trial of the accused.

In detail, the first accused said that, while he was with his friends in a restaurant, he saw the second accused, accompanied by five others, and asked him: “Why are you talking to our late friend on WhatsApp?”

He explained that the second defendant slapped him on the face and on the head, and some of the people present hit him without being able to defend himself, which led to his fall to the ground as a result of losing consciousness, pointing out that he received a message via the application of "WhatsApp" indicating the death of one of his friends present. In the group, he responded to the message that what is being circulated is a lie and their friend has not died.

A witness in the case indicated that he and the first accused were leaving the restaurant, and eight people came to them, and told his friend: “Why do you curses the deceased?” Which was denied by the first accused, and confirmed that he respected the deceased and did not insult him, and two people beat him.

Another witness in the case stated that one of them constantly punched the first accused in the face, while the second accused grabbed him and two others slapped him, while two other people were watching the situation without interfering, and when the first accused fell on the ground to escape from the place, and they asked him not to Report the incident to the police.

He explained that as soon as he called the police, one of them threatened to beat him, indicating that he did not know the accused, and this was the first time he saw them.

For his part, the second accused admitted that he was accompanied by his friend and saw the first accused in the place, and there was a previous dispute between them through a social media program, and he went to talk to him about insulting his deceased friend, which was denied by the first accused.

He continued: "An argument occurred between us because he cursed my deceased friend, and pushed me with his hand, so I slapped him in the face, and I fell on the chair, so he tried to get up to hit me and punched him, just as he punched you with his hands, and then the rest of the friends came, so they separated us.
